What is the Motley Fool?

Quite simply, the Motley Fool is an investment research and analysis company that offers free and paid information for investors. They are most well-known for their Stock Advisor service, which is a subscription-based monthly newsletter. The newsletter offers stock picks, in-depth company analysis, recommendations to buy stocks, and much more.
